#1810f2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1810f2 is composed of 9.4% red, 6.3%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.1% cyan, 93.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 242.1 degrees, a saturation of 89.7% and a lightness of 50.6%. #1810f2 color hex could be obtained by blending #3020ff with #0000e5. Closest websafe color is: #0000ff.

#1810f2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1810f2 has RGB values of R:24, G:16, B:242 and CMYK values of C:0.9, M:0.93, Y:0,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 1577202.
